Completed another pet portrait for a friend of my fathers recently. I took pictures of the process so I could share it here. My last picture was a bit better I think; but I still feel I am progressing with watercolors.

Here is the picture my dad sent me to approximate for his friend. Truffie looks like a such a cutie.
I started in with watercolor pencil and outlined where every bit of Truffie would be.

Then I washed him in with water, and the immediate results are ugly as usual. I wonder if I might change this tactic next time. A dryer brush perhaps; or going right in with watercolor?

Then I started on the floor. I am being critical of myself; I know some warping is normal but I think I should be more minimalist with huge washes of color in the future.

Next I added in the darker areas.

Then added details.

Then I looked closer at the computer image (I had printed out an image) to fill in details I had missed.

I need to practice more with doggies before I do my next portrait. It has been fun though.

Very well done, compliments! I know how difficult it is, to do any larger area with watercolor. I used to practice it by just filling larger and larger squares with a color as evenly as possible. Not sure if the use of watercolor pencils makes it easier, for it is easier to use lighter colors with more water, so I find it amazing, how you accomplished your painting.
